How much do contract aconex j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for contract aconex in the United States is $21.73,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$25.00 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are common challenges faced by professionals working in a Contract Aconex role,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in a Contract Aconex role often face challenges related to managing large volumes of project documentation and ensuring timely communication among multiple stakeholders. Staying organized and maintaining up-to-date records within the Aconex platform is crucial, as missed documents or delayed approvals can lead to project delays. To address these challenges, it's important to develop strong attention to detail, regularly audit document workflows, and proactively communicate with team members and external partners to resolve issues quickly. Familiarity with Aconex functionalities and ongoing training can further help streamline processes and prevent errors.

What is a Contract Aconex?

A Contract Aconex refers to a professional who specializes in managing and administering project information using the Aconex platform, particularly in the context of contractual documentation and processes. Aconex is a widely used construction project management software that facilitates document control, project communication, and workflow management. Contract Aconex professionals ensure that all contractual documents, correspondence, and approvals are accurately tracked and accessible throughout the project's lifecycle. Their expertise helps teams maintain compliance, avoid disputes, and achieve project deliverables efficiently.

What is the difference between Contract Aconex vs Contract Administrator?

AspectContract AconexContract Administrator
Primary RoleManaging project documentation and workflows using Aconex platformOverseeing contract compliance, amendments, and administrative tasks
Required SkillsProficiency in Aconex software, document control, project managementContract management, negotiation, administrative skills
Work EnvironmentConstruction, engineering, infrastructure projectsConstruction sites, corporate offices, project sites
CertificationsOften requires project management or document control certificationsLegal or contract management certifications beneficial

While Contract Aconex specialists focus on managing project documentation through the Aconex platform, Contract Administrators handle broader contract oversight and compliance. Both roles are essential in construction projects but differ in scope and daily responsibilities.

The Construction Cost Manager is responsible for the financial control, planning, and management of all capital expenditure projects related to the design, construction, and fit-out of WHSmith's new and refurbished retail units in aviation and casinos. This role involves working closely with Design, Construction, and Procurement teams to ensure projects are delivered within budget, maximizing value, and adhering to strict airport operational constraints and timelines.

Budgeting and Forecasting
  • Establish and maintain detailed project budgets, working with specialists and providing accurate cost estimates (concept to final design) for construction, fit-out, and fixed assets.
  • Conduct comprehensive cost planning and financial feasibility studies for all potential retail unit locations in compliance with airport specific requirements.
  • Manage forecasting and reporting project expenditures, identifying potential variances and implementing corrective actions proactively.
  • Analyze historical data to provide benchmark cost-per-square-foot placeholder estimates to Finance for initial high-level P&L analysis.
  • Develop detailed cost models for use in accurate estimation and value engineering activities.

Cost Control and Value Manager
  • Implement robust cost control systems and processes to track actual expenditure against approved budgets from estimate to final account.
  • Lead and support on value engineering (VE) initiatives by providing clear cost breakdowns and challenging specifications and construction methodologies to achieve cost savings without compromising design quality or functionality.
  • Manage directly and/or support the project manager to negotiate variations, change orders, and final accounts with contractors, suppliers, and consultants.
  • Prepare and present detailed financial project reports and cost summaries to senior management and project stakeholders.
  • Process all cost functions through the approved Enterprise Cost Management System [ACONEX at time of writing] including submission of and inputting contract data and documentation.
  • Drive the change management process through the cost management systems.
  • Support the project manager in the successful delivery of projects.

Tendering and Procurement Support
  • Support and/or Lead on Category Procurement Management activity ensuring clear RFIs and RFQs Negotiate and manage supplier contracts and pricing agreements to secure best value, ensure supply continuity and compliance.
  • Benchmark current material specifications and supplier performance internally and externally to drive continuous improvement
  • Proactively challenge internal stakeholder specifications to identify and eliminate over-engineered or inefficient items
  • Manage the purchasing process for bulk stock and specialized equipment, balancing supply constraints with material requirements.
  • Develop and manage tender documentation (Bills of Quantities, Scope of Works) for main contractors and specialist trades.
  • Assist and sometimes lead on Procurement with the financial evaluation of tender submissions and contract negotiations to ensure best commercial terms.
  • Benchmark costs against industry standards and previous projects, specifically within the airport/retail sector.

Administration and Compliance
  • Ensure compliance with all internal financial controls, corporate governance, and airport-specific financial/contractual regulations.
  • Oversee contract administration duties, ensuring accurate and timely payment certification and cash flow management.
